CCTV& CRIME PREVENTION Perceptions & Reality There an estimated 1.85 million CCTV cameras in the UK, that is 1 for every 32 people! = 1x This is far fewer than the oft-quoted figure of 4.2 million cameras Of these cameras, a majority are privately owned: Cameras on Public Transport = 115,000 (6.2%) Publicly Owned Cameras = 33,433 (1.8%) A majority of the public approve of CCTV systems: 100 80 PUBLIC 60 93% APPROVAL 40 89% 86% 84% (%) 20 63% do not think CCTV poses a problem 81% believe CCTV helps the Police fight crime TUBE OUTSIDE BANKS HIGH STREET NETWORK PUBS LOCATIONS Effectiveness CRIME SCENE DO NOT CRIME SCENE DO NOT CROSS CRIME SCENE DO NOT CROSS Mobduo As many as 7 in 10 murders are solved thanks to CCTV, and 95% of Scotland Yard Murder cases used CCTV footage as evidence.
